Speech‑Language Pathologist (SLP) School‑Based Position Near Citrus Heights, CA
We are seeking a dedicated and student-focused Speech‑Language Pathologist to join a school‑based team. This position offers the opportunity to work collaboratively with educators, families, and support staff to help students achieve their communication and academic goals.
Setting: School‑Based
Schedule: Full-time
Start Date: ASAP–EOSY
Employment type: Contract with potential for renewal
Responsibilities
Evaluate and provide therapy services for students with speech, language, articulation, fluency, voice, and pragmatic disorders.
Develop and implement individualized education programs (IEPs).
Participate in IEP meetings, evaluations, and progress monitoring.
Maintain accurate and timely documentation in compliance with district and state guidelines.
Collaborate with teachers, special education staff, and families to support student success.
Provide consultative services and classroom-based support as needed.
Qualifications
Master’s degree in Speech‑Language Pathology.
Active or eligible state SLP license.
CCC‑SLP preferred; CFY candidates considered.
School‑based or pediatric experience preferred but not required.
Strong communication, organization, and collaboration skills.
